SMS doesn't get backed up to your Google account -- saved messages are only saved locally to the phone, so a factory reset will wipe them. You need to use a 3rd party app like SMS Backup & Restore beforehand. Email accounts can always be added back to the email app, but if you were using a POP3 server and downloading copies of your emails to the phone (and deleting the copy on the server), then those also don't get backed up to your Google account, and would also be wiped with a factory reset. That's one reason why IMAP is a better idea than POP3 -- the emails remain on the server with IMAP unless you delete them there.
